Being familiar with the Core Principles of Hydraulic Technology

At the heart of hydraulic Technology is Pascal's Legislation, which states that force placed on a confined fluid is transmitted undiminished in all directions. This theory allows for the era of huge drive with fairly modest enter Electrical power, creating hydraulics ideal for weighty-obligation jobs. Hydraulic units typically consist of a pump (which generates movement), valves (which Management course, force, and move), actuators (which transform hydraulic Electrical power into mechanical motion), and fluid reservoirs.

Using hydraulic fluids—ordinarily oil—permits units to generate, control, and immediate Power with Remarkable precision. Unlike mechanical systems, where friction can lead to dress in and tear, hydraulic techniques use fluid to generate clean motion, which lowers servicing necessities and boosts toughness. This adaptability would make hydraulics critical in industries where by heavy hundreds, superior precision, or elaborate actions are needed.

Essential Programs of Hydraulic Technology Across Industries

Hydraulics play a significant job in various sectors, which include development, manufacturing, and transportation. In the development Industry, For illustration, hydraulics are definitely the backbone of equipment which include excavators, bulldozers, cranes, and backhoes. These devices depend on hydraulic Power to carry, thrust, and transfer massive masses with ease. The development of skyscrapers, highways, and bridges would not be probable without the drive and suppleness of hydraulic equipment.

In manufacturing, hydraulic presses and forming equipment shape and mould resources with precision. The ability to implement constant, managed pressure makes it possible for producers to operate with metals, plastics, as well as other elements effectively. Whether or not It is really stamping car or truck pieces or shaping sensitive electronic factors, hydraulics be certain that manufacturing processes are each potent and correct.

During the transportation sector, hydraulics are integral for the Procedure of plane, ships, and motor vehicles. Plane use hydraulic methods to control landing gear, brakes, and flight Management surfaces, though ships use hydraulics for steering, winching, and cargo handling. In cars, Power steering and braking systems count on hydraulic mechanisms to supply motorists with Handle and safety. The use of hydraulics in these applications enables smooth and trustworthy Procedure, specifically in units in which mechanical Power by yourself might be inadequate.

Benefits of Hydraulic Systems More than Mechanical and Electrical Techniques

One of the greatest strengths of hydraulic programs is their capacity to crank out monumental quantities of power in the compact Room. Although mechanical programs demand huge components to produce identical pressure, hydraulic programs can obtain higher Power density through the utilization of fluid stress. This permits for lesser, additional effective styles which can be effective at doing hefty-responsibility duties with out occupying abnormal space.

Also, hydraulic methods present exceptional Command and precision. The ability to high-quality-tune force and flow allows operators to execute jobs with a substantial diploma of precision. This is especially essential in industries like aerospace, wherever even the smallest deviation in motion or drive can have significant outcomes. In distinction to electrical systems, which may are afflicted with interference or Power decline, hydraulic systems offer regular, trusted Power even in complicated environments.

An additional advantage is the durability and robustness of hydraulic techniques. The usage of fluid instead of sound mechanical linkages lowers friction and don, which prolongs the lifespan with the equipment. This will make hydraulic units extra well suited for severe environments, for instance mining functions or offshore oil rigs, in which equipment is subjected to Severe pressures, temperatures, and corrosive factors.

Technological Breakthroughs and the Future of Hydraulic Systems

The evolution of hydraulic Technology proceeds, driven by developments in supplies, design, and automation. Contemporary hydraulic programs have become more economical, cutting down Strength consumption and improving upon effectiveness. By way of example, variable displacement pumps and load-sensing Technology make it possible for for more specific control of fluid stream, which minimizes Power squander and enhances Over-all system efficiency.

Also, the integration of electronic systems and automation is transforming hydraulic devices into wise units. Sensors, controllers, and true-time checking resources are getting used to improve hydraulic efficiency, forecast routine maintenance wants, and enrich safety. These innovations are paving how for hydraulic systems to Perform a critical role in the development of autonomous machines and robotic programs, significantly in industries like manufacturing, agriculture, and logistics.

As environmental considerations increase, the Industry is usually focusing on making a lot more sustainable hydraulic devices. New fluid formulations which have been biodegradable and eco-friendly are increasingly being developed, and hydraulic methods have become a lot more Strength-productive to lessen their environmental impression. These enhancements are important as industries request to harmony the necessity for Power and efficiency With all the demand for sustainability.
